What's the minimum ad spend?

For Google Ads, we recommend a minimum of $2,500/month — below that, there isn't enough signal for Smart Bidding to optimize effectively. For Meta (Tier 2), a minimum of $1,000/month on top of Google. These are recommendations based on what it takes to generate enough data to optimize, not hard requirements.

How long until I see results?

Google Ads typically needs 30-60 days to learn your account before performance stabilizes. Local Services Ads can produce leads faster once Google Guarantee verification clears. Meta builds over a longer horizon — it's a memory layer, not an instant-lead channel. Anyone promising leads in week one is selling you something we won't.

Do I own my ad accounts?

Always. Your Google Ads and Meta accounts stay in your name, paid with your payment method, fully owned by you. We manage them through operator-level access (Google MCC, Meta Business Manager partner access). If we ever part ways, your accounts and all their history stay with you.
